In my experience (I'm Chair of the Sydenham Society's conservation and planning committee) a conversion such as the one that was going on at Church Rise should have had planning permission before the second lot of work started, and the developer should have displayed the yellow notice way before planning permission was given; in addition, neighbours should have received letters of consultation so that they could object. Of course some developers start work and then apply retrospectively - in a sense, the Council relies on neignbours and amenity societies (the Sydenham Society and the Forest Hill Society) to be its 'eyes and ears'. Re any subsequent development - there is no guarantee of a 'like for like' building unless Church Rise is in a conservation area (and even then this is not guaranteed, as planners and architects are not keen on a 'pastiche' approach, largely because the building materials, techniques and craftsmanship available to the Victorians and Edwardians is either not available or too expensive for today's developers / house builders). As has been explored on SE23.com on other threads, there has been a call for more conservation areas in SE23 - the best approach is to join the Forest Hill Society and get them involved (if you are not already a member).
